Transaction 3d8f8459f0239201ba59f7242b7e83a756c86e3d2ba661e2141abfe43d8bbccd
1 Input
1 Output
-
3d8f8459f0239201ba59f7242b7e83a756c86e3d2ba661e2141abfe43d8bbccd:0
- value
- 508003
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a17311fbf1cf7de74c54d25c86307022ea73069
- address
- bc1q8gtnz8alrnmauax9f5juscc8qgh2wvrft8z0zg